About

Nellie Kalcheva is a scholar working on Molecular Biology, Cell Biology and Genetics. According to data from OpenAlex, Nellie Kalcheva has authored 14 papers receiving a total of 490 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Molecular Biology, 8 papers in Cell Biology and 2 papers in Genetics. Recurrent topics in Nellie Kalcheva’s work include Microtubule and mitosis dynamics (8 papers), Ubiquitin and proteasome pathways (5 papers) and Genomics and Chromatin Dynamics (2 papers). Nellie Kalcheva is often cited by papers focused on Microtubule and mitosis dynamics (8 papers), Ubiquitin and proteasome pathways (5 papers) and Genomics and Chromatin Dynamics (2 papers). Nellie Kalcheva collaborates with scholars based in United States and Bulgaria. Nellie Kalcheva's co-authors include Bridget Shafit‐Zagardo, Joanna S. Albala, Yvonne Kress, Craig C. Garner, Zhiyong Wang, David C. Spray, Luis I. García, Jie Zhang, Paul D. Lampe and Jiaxiang Qu and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of Neurochemistry and The American Journal of Cardiology.
